Alex Anton is an ascending American professional poker player and a new force on the international high-stakes tournament circuit. Originally from Miami, Florida, Anton has rapidly transitioned from a dominant regional player to a global competitor, securing major results across the United States, the Bahamas, and South Korea. In mid-2026, he solidified his status as an elite champion by capturing his first career World Series of Poker (WSOP) gold bracelet in Las Vegas. Known for his tactical aggression and ability to navigate elite-tier final tables, Anton has officially surpassed the $1.5 million live earnings milestone and is currently one of the fastest-climbing players in the Global Poker Index (GPI) rankings.
Career Earnings & Biggest Results
As of June 2026, Alex Anton’s total live tournament earnings have reached $1,543,901, according to The Hendon Mob. His career-best live score came at the 2026 World Series of Poker , where he won Event #51: $10,000 Mystery Bounty No-Limit Hold’em for a massive $678,300 top prize . His previous tournament highlight occurred in August 2025, when he won the Seminole Hard Rock Poker Open $10,000 Deep Stack for $288,000. He carried that momentum into 2026, highlighted by a 10th-place finish in the Triton Poker Jeju $20,000 NLHE 8-Handed event for $86,500 and a 4th-place finish in the LAPC $10,000 Main Event. With a rapidly growing resume of high-stakes cashes, Anton’s estimated poker net worth is currently valued at approximately $2.2 million.

Biography & Poker Background
Alex Anton emerged as a formidable talent from the Florida poker scene, initially making waves in the high-stakes games at the Seminole Hard Rock in Hollywood. His transition to the national stage was swift, as he began securing major titles on the World Poker Tour (WPT) circuit and the WSOP International Circuit. In late 2025, Anton gained worldwide attention during the WSOP Paradise in the Bahamas, where he secured back-to-back deep runs in high-buy-in bracelet events. By early 2026, he became a regular fixture on the Triton Poker Series, traveling to major hubs like South Korea to test his skills against the world’s absolute best. In mid-2026, he achieved a career milestone at the 57th Annual WSOP in Las Vegas, overcoming a field of 558 players to win his first career gold bracelet. Based in Miami, Anton is recognized for his intense study of Game Theory Optimal (GTO) play and is widely considered one of the top “new school” American pros.
Play Style & Strategy
Anton is known for a balanced and highly aggressive tournament style. His greatest technical edge lies in Short-Handed (7-max and 8-max) No-Limit Hold’em structures, where his ability to apply pressure in late-stage scenarios is considered elite. Strategically, he is a proponent of high-frequency aggression, utilizing his understanding of stack dynamics to out-navigate veteran opponents. In his 2026 WSOP Mystery Bounty victory, he put on a clinical performance as the final table chip leader, successfully navigating the pressure cooker elements of the bounty format and deploying masterclass short-stack ICM strategies to eliminate multiple players en route to the title. Fellow players often point to his composed demeanor and meticulous hand-range construction as his standout technical traits.
